There are 2 ways to get from Magelang to Merak by taxi, plane, bus, or train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Taxi to Ahmad Yani, fly, taxi
best- Take the taxi from Magelang to Ahmad Yani (SRG)
- Fly from Ahmad Yani (SRG) to Kushok Bakula Rimpochee Airport (IXL)SRG - IXL
- Take the taxi from Kushok Bakula Rimpochee Airport (IXL) to Merak
19h 59m₹26,729–70,780Bus, train to Yogyakarta International Airport, fly, taxi
cheapest- Take the bus from Magelang Kota to Yogyakarta
- Take the train from Yogyakarta Tugu Station to Yogyakarta International Airport
- Fly from Yogyakarta International Airport (YIA) to Kushok Bakula Rimpochee Airport (IXL)YIA - IXL
- Take the taxi from Kushok Bakula Rimpochee Airport (IXL) to Merak
23h 15m₹24,012–65,118
Ahmad Yani (SRG) to Kushok Bakula Rimpochee Airport (IXL) flights
Questions & Answers
The cheapest way to get from Magelang to Merak is to bus and train and fly and taxi which costs ₹24,000 - ₹65,000 and takes 23h 15m.
The fastest way to get from Magelang to Merak is to taxi and fly which takes 19h 59m and costs ₹26,000 - ₹75,000.
The distance between Magelang and Merak is 5982 km.
It takes approximately 19h 59m to get from Magelang to Merak, including transfers.
Merak is 1h 30m behind Magelang. It is currently 3:22 AM in Magelang and 1:52 AM in Merak.
There are 19+ hotels available in Merak.
What companies run services between Magelang, Indonesia and Merak, India?
There is no direct connection from Magelang to Merak. However, you can take the taxi to Ahmad Yani (SRG) airport, fly to Kushok Bakula Rimpochee Airport (IXL), then take the taxi to Merak. Alternatively, you can take the bus to Yogyakarta, walk to Lempuyangan, take the bus to Gramedia, take the bus to Tugu Station, walk to Yogyakarta Tugu Station, take the train to Yogyakarta International Airport, walk to Yogyakarta International Airport (YIA) airport, fly to Kushok Bakula Rimpochee Airport (IXL), then take the taxi to Merak.
- Website
- goindigo.in
Flights from Ahmad Yani to Kushok Bakula Rimpochee Airport via Soekarno–Hatta, Mumbai
- Ave. Duration
- 22h 55m
- When
- Every day
- Estimated price
- ₹26,000–70,000
Flights from Ahmad Yani to Kushok Bakula Rimpochee Airport via Soekarno–Hatta, Singapore Changi, Delhi
- Ave. Duration
- 25h 2m
- When
- Monday to Saturday
- Estimated price
- ₹24,000–70,000
Flights from Yogyakarta International Airport to Kushok Bakula Rimpochee Airport via Soekarno–Hatta, Mumbai
- Ave. Duration
- 22h 20m
- When
- Every day
- Estimated price
- ₹25,000–70,000
Flights from Yogyakarta International Airport to Kushok Bakula Rimpochee Airport via Singapore Changi, Delhi
- Ave. Duration
- 24h 40m
- When
- Every day
- Estimated price
- ₹23,000–65,000
- Website
- airindia.in
Flights from Ahmad Yani to Kushok Bakula Rimpochee Airport via Singapore Changi, Delhi
- Ave. Duration
- 16h 40m
- When
- Tuesday
- Estimated price
- ₹22,000–65,000
Flights from Ahmad Yani to Kushok Bakula Rimpochee Airport via Soekarno–Hatta, Singapore Changi, Delhi
- Ave. Duration
- 18h 5m
- When
- Every day
- Estimated price
- ₹22,000–65,000
Flights from Yogyakarta International Airport to Kushok Bakula Rimpochee Airport via Kuala Lumpur, Delhi
- Ave. Duration
- 16h 5m
- When
- Tuesday, Wednesday, Friday, Saturday, and Sunday
- Estimated price
- ₹21,000–60,000
- Website
- spicejet.com
Flights from Ahmad Yani to Kushok Bakula Rimpochee Airport via Singapore Changi, Delhi
- Ave. Duration
- 16h
- When
- Tuesday
- Estimated price
- ₹22,000–65,000
Flights from Yogyakarta International Airport to Kushok Bakula Rimpochee Airport via Kuala Lumpur, Delhi
- Ave. Duration
- 18h 52m
- When
- Every day
- Estimated price
- ₹21,000–90,000
- info@railink.co.id
- Website
- railink.co.id
Train from Yogyakarta Tugu Station to Yogyakarta International Airport
- Ave. Duration
- 35 min
- Frequency
- Hourly
- Estimated price
- ₹100–270
- Schedules at
- railink.co.id
- Phone
- (021) 1500 825
- humas@damri.co.id
- Website
- damri.co.id
Bus from Magelang Kota to Yogyakarta
- Ave. Duration
- 1h
- Frequency
- Once daily
- Estimated price
- ₹70–1,400
- Book at
- https://12go.asia/en/operator/damri
- Ave. Duration
- 2h 32m
- Estimated price
- ₹1,900–3,500
TaxiBazaar
- Phone
- +9 -9876661275
- Website
- taxibazaar.in
TaxiBazaar
- Phone
- +9 -9876661275
- Website
- taxibazaar.in
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including How to get from JFK to New York City, Train travel in Spain: A guide to Renfe, and How to get from London City Airport into central London - to help you get the most out of your next trip.




